Yumyum Tree - Oasis Muharraq 2.3

Muharraq,
Bahrain

About Yumyum Tree - Oasis Muharraq

Yumyum Tree - Oasis Muharraq Yumyum Tree - Oasis Muharraq is a well known place listed as Food Stand in Muharraq , Continental Restaurant in Muharraq ,

Contact Details & Working Hours